Eubacterial and archaeal community identification in historically contaminated subsurface sediment and community shift during PHC degradation under given experimental conditions. Historically contaminated subsurface sediment was used to monitor hydrocarbon degradation behavoir under sulphate reducing and methanogenic conditions over 450 days. Total RNA was isolated from experimental sets and reverse-transcribed to cDNAs. Phylogenetic marker gene 16S rDNA was amplified with eubacterial and archaeal universal primers and amplicons were sequenced on Roche 454 sequencing platform.
